Why Noise Levels Matter for Open-Plan Living
Noise levels are measured in decibels (dB), a logarithmic scale where each 10 dB increase represents a perceived doubling of loudness. Understanding these measurements helps you choose a dishwasher that won't disrupt your home environment.
For open-plan living, 45 dB or lower is the sweet spot. At this level, you can easily have conversations, conduct video calls, and enjoy your living space without the dishwasher being a distraction. Most modern quiet portable dishwashers fall within this range thanks to advanced insulation and noise-dampening technologies.

How Dishwasher Noise Is Measured
Understanding how dishwasher noise is measured helps you interpret specifications and make informed comparisons. The decibel (dB) scale is logarithmic, meaning the difference between 40 dB and 45 dB is actually more significant than the numbers suggest.

How Manufacturers Test Noise:
Most manufacturers measure dishwasher noise using standardized test methods defined by ISO (International Organization for Standardization) standards. The measurements are taken during active washing cycles at a distance of approximately 1 meter (3.3 feet) from the unit.
Portable dishwashers typically have three noise levels:
- Fill/Drain Cycles: Often quieter as the motor isn't working hard
- Normal Wash Cycles: Mid-range noise during spray arm rotation and water circulation
- Heating Cycles: Can be slightly louder when water is being heated
For open-plan living, you want a model where the normal wash cycle doesn't exceed 45 dB. All models in our top 5 list meet this criterion.
Tips to Reduce Dishwasher Noise in Your Home
Even with a quiet dishwasher, there are additional steps you can take to minimize noise in your open-plan kitchen:
1. Proper Installation
Level your portable dishwasher carefully. An unlevel unit can vibrate during operation, increasing perceived noise. Use leveling feet or shims to ensure it's perfectly level on your countertop or floor. For more detailed installation guidance, see our installation guide.
2. Isolation Pads
Purchase vibration isolation pads designed for appliances. Place these under your dishwasher's legs to absorb vibrations before they transfer to your countertop or floor. This simple addition can reduce perceived noise by 2-3 dB.
3. Strategic Placement
Position your dishwasher away from open stairwells, windows, and hard surfaces that reflect sound. An island kitchen with the dishwasher facing a solid wall will have better sound absorption than one facing an open area.
4. Use Longer Cycle Times
Most quiet dishwashers offer both quick (30-45 minute) and standard (1.5-2 hour) cycles. The longer cycles run at lower intensity and often produce less noise. Use these during daytime hours when you're home and can tolerate occasional machine sounds.
5. Regular Maintenance
A well-maintained dishwasher operates more quietly. Clean filters regularly, check spray arms for debris, and descale the unit monthly. For comprehensive maintenance tips, read our maintenance guide.
6. Soft-Close Doors
While not applicable to all portable models, soft-close mechanisms reduce the impact noise when opening and closing. This adds to the overall quiet experience.

Generally, yes. Smaller motors and chambers can produce less noise. The COMFEE' Mini operates at 41 dB compared to the full-size COMFEE' Energy Star at 42 dB. However, the difference is minimal. Compact dishwashers are quieter because they use smaller, less powerful motors, not because they have superior insulation.
Quick wash cycles (30-45 minutes) run at higher intensity with more powerful jets, which can produce slightly more noise. Standard cycles (1.5-2 hours) run at lower intensity, distributing the cleaning action over a longer period, which results in quieter operation. If noise is your priority, choose standard cycle times.
Not necessarily. Energy Star certification focuses on water and energy efficiency, not noise levels. However, efficient washing cycles often run at lower intensity, which can produce less noise.
